Толчки при ref all home
Добавлено: 18 май 2025, 11:54
				
				Здравствуйте!
Мач3, ось В настроена как slave axis по отношению к оси У. При одомашнивании оси У она едет, как положено, назад, затем немного вперёд, затем снова назад мотором В, снова вперёд означенным мотором. Пока что всё хорошо. Но после этого (в львиной доле случаев, но отчего-то не всегда!) она производит громкий толчок (ну или рывок, я не штангист) мотором В! И едет при этом немного назад (видимо, игнорируя настройки максимального ускорения, откуда и рывок).
Более того, порою после процедуры одомашнивания остаётся нажат концевик, причём в некоторых случаях боярский, а в некоторых - напротив, холопский, а порою и вовсе по совсем другой оси. Особенно часто (но не всегда) это происходит, ежели подвинуть концевик в рамках юстировки. И в рамках этой же юстировки, судя по всему, мач далеко не с первого раза понимает, что концевик подвинут, а норовит прийти рабской осью в ту же координату, что была у неё доселе. Я прописал одомашнивание оси В отдельно после оси У, теперь с подсасыванием координат вроде стало получше, зато теперь я имею честь слышать ажно два рывка.
В свете вышеизложенного у меня возникают справедливые (на мой взгляд) вопросы:
- Отчего вообще мачу понадобилось ехать назад уже после того, как он налез на концевик и успешно слез с такового? Я не вижу ни одной причины этого делать, кроме как позлить оператора.
- Можно ли от означенных толчков как-то избавиться?
- Быть может, можно как-то написать свою процедуру одомашнивания? Я пытался, но у меня не получилось включить override limits ни программно, ни экранно-мышечно (отключение auto limit override также не помогает).
Заранее благодарен.
			Мач3, ось В настроена как slave axis по отношению к оси У. При одомашнивании оси У она едет, как положено, назад, затем немного вперёд, затем снова назад мотором В, снова вперёд означенным мотором. Пока что всё хорошо. Но после этого (в львиной доле случаев, но отчего-то не всегда!) она производит громкий толчок (ну или рывок, я не штангист) мотором В! И едет при этом немного назад (видимо, игнорируя настройки максимального ускорения, откуда и рывок).
Более того, порою после процедуры одомашнивания остаётся нажат концевик, причём в некоторых случаях боярский, а в некоторых - напротив, холопский, а порою и вовсе по совсем другой оси. Особенно часто (но не всегда) это происходит, ежели подвинуть концевик в рамках юстировки. И в рамках этой же юстировки, судя по всему, мач далеко не с первого раза понимает, что концевик подвинут, а норовит прийти рабской осью в ту же координату, что была у неё доселе. Я прописал одомашнивание оси В отдельно после оси У, теперь с подсасыванием координат вроде стало получше, зато теперь я имею честь слышать ажно два рывка.
В свете вышеизложенного у меня возникают справедливые (на мой взгляд) вопросы:
- Отчего вообще мачу понадобилось ехать назад уже после того, как он налез на концевик и успешно слез с такового? Я не вижу ни одной причины этого делать, кроме как позлить оператора.
- Можно ли от означенных толчков как-то избавиться?
- Быть может, можно как-то написать свою процедуру одомашнивания? Я пытался, но у меня не получилось включить override limits ни программно, ни экранно-мышечно (отключение auto limit override также не помогает).
Заранее благодарен.